Definitions:

Estimated Line of Cost Behavior

A projection or estimation of how costs change in relation to changes in an organization’s level of activity.

High-Low Method

An accounting technique used to estimate variable and fixed costs associated with a business activity by analyzing the highest and lowest levels of activity.

Scatter Diagram

A graphical representation used to show the relationship between two variables, often used in statistics and quality control to identify potential correlations.

Degree of Operating Leverage (DOL)

A measure of how much a company's operating income will change in response to a change in sales, indicating the company's sensitivity to changes in business volume.
